The Birth of Electronic Device Registration Systems: With the increasing importance of technology in education, US universities began implementing electronic device registration systems to better manage and track devices used on campus. These systems allow students to register their devices, ensuring they comply with university policies and guidelines. By registering their devices, students can access university networks, connect to Wi-Fi, and receive support if any issues arise. This process promotes a secure and efficient technology environment within the campus. 2. Advantages of Electronic Device Registration: Electronic device registration offers numerous benefits for both students and universities. Firstly, it helps universities keep track of the devices being used on their networks, making it easier to identify any unauthorized or suspicious activities. Additionally, registration allows universities to collect valuable data about the types of devices used by students, enabling them to adapt their technology infrastructure accordingly. Lastly, device registration allows universities to provide timely and targeted support for technical issues, ensuring a smooth experience for students. 3. The Rise of Electronic Signatures: Another significant development in US universities is the adoption of electronic signatures. Traditionally, administrative processes, such as signing documents, required physical presence and paper-based signatures. However, electronic signatures have simplified and streamlined these processes, saving time and reducing paperwork. Electronic signatures offer convenience and security by allowing users to sign documents digitally from anywhere, resulting in increased efficiency and improved workflows. 4. Benefits of Electronic Signatures: The integration of electronic signatures in US universities brings a multitude of advantages. Firstly, it eliminates the need for physical presence, providing flexibility for both university staff and students. This is especially beneficial for students studying remotely or participating in online courses. Secondly, electronic signatures enhance security by ensuring the integrity and authenticity of signed documents. Additionally, electronic signatures significantly reduce paper consumption, contributing to a more sustainable environment. 5. Use Cases for Electronic Signatures in Universities: Electronic signatures are widely utilized in various administrative processes within US universities. Admissions, enrollment, financial aid, and academic registrations all require documentation that traditionally involved physical signatures. By implementing electronic signatures, universities have simplified these processes, enabling students to complete necessary paperwork digitally and reducing paperwork-related delays.
